Understanding Louisiana Asbestos Litigation: A Comprehensive Guide

Asbestos exposure positions considerable health risks, causing severe diseases such as asbestosis, mesothelioma, and lung cancer. In states like Louisiana, where historical industries greatly used asbestos, legal fights around asbestos-related claims are prevalent. This article checks out the complexities of asbestos litigation in Louisiana, clarifying the legal landscape, recent patterns, and regularly asked questions.

Asbestos and Its Risks in Louisiana

Historically, numerous markets in Louisiana Asbestos Cancer, including shipbuilding, oil refining, and production, made use of asbestos for its insulation residential or commercial properties and resistance to heat and chemicals. While reliable, the threats of asbestos exposure ended up being significantly obvious, resulting in more stringent policies and a surge in litigation by affected people.

Understanding Asbestos-related Diseases

Before diving into litigation specifics, it is necessary to recognize the diseases linked to asbestos exposure:

DiseaseDescription
AsbestosisA persistent lung condition arising from breathing in asbestos fibers, triggering lung scarring and breathing troubles.
Mesothelioma LouisianaA rare and aggressive cancer mainly affecting the lining of the lungs (pleura) or abdominal area (peritoneum) linked to asbestos exposure.
Lung CancerCancers of the lung credited to prolonged exposure to carcinogenic asbestos fibers.
Other CancersOther forms of cancer, such as intestinal and laryngeal cancers, have actually likewise been connected to asbestos exposure.

The Legal Framework for Asbestos Claims in Louisiana

Louisiana's legal system provides a pathway for people seeking compensation for asbestos-related injuries. The litigation process can be complex and prolonged, often requiring substantial documentation and legal support. Below is a simplified summary of the stages associated with the asbestos litigation procedure:

Stage in LitigationDescription
Initial ConsultationSatisfying with a certified attorney to discuss potential claims and gather essential details.
InvestigationA comprehensive investigation is carried out involving medical records, work history, and exposure proof.
Filing a ClaimThe attorney submits a lawsuit in the suitable jurisdiction, specifying the nature of the claim and proof.
Discovery ProcessBoth parties collect and exchange proof, including depositions and files relevant to the case.
TrialIf no settlement is reached, the case may go to trial where proof exists before a judge or jury.
Settlement NegotiationMany asbestos claims are fixed through settlements before reaching trial, aiming to expedite compensation.

Usage of Trust Funds

Many business that historically utilized asbestos have established bankruptcy trust funds to compensate victims. In Louisiana, plaintiffs often pursue these funds as part of their claim, together with standard litigation routes.

Class Action Lawsuits

Class actions have actually ended up being more commonplace, where numerous plaintiffs sign up with together versus a typical defendant. This method can help enhance the legal process, minimize expenses, and increase the possibilities of beneficial outcomes.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What evidence is required to submit an asbestos claim in Louisiana?A: Claimants require medical paperwork showing their asbestos-related health problem, evidence of exposure (such as work history), and any pertinent files linking their condition to specific asbestos use.

Q: How long does it take to solve an asbestos claim?A: The timeline differs depending upon the case intricacy. Some claims settle within months, while others may take years, specifically if they proceed to trial.

Q: Can I file a claim on behalf of a deceased member of the family?A: Yes, Louisiana Lung Cancer Asbestos Exposure Lawsuit law allows relative to submit wrongful death claims if the departed individual suffered from an asbestos-related disease.

Q: Are there any costs related to employing an asbestos attorney?A: Many asbestos att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, suggesting they only get paid if you win compensation. This incentivizes them to provide the very best possible outcome.
